Google Glass getting a stylish makeover

Google announced late Monday that it is joining forces with eyewear giant Luxottica to design, develop and distribute a new generation of Glass. Glass, Google's experimental gadget that places a notification screen above your eye, initially launched in 2013 as an exciting futuristic product. Since then, it has become an overhyped niche gadget with a public relations problem. By appearing more stylish, Google is hoping Glass may gain broader market appeal before it releases the product to the broader public toward the end of 2014. Luxottica and Google will establish a team of experts devoted to working on new Glass products "that straddle the line between high-fashion, lifestyle and innovative technology," the eyewear company says. The frames firm -- the largest eyewear company in the world -- manufactures glasses for Oakley, Persol, Prada, Ray-Ban and Versace. It also owns retailers including LensCrafters, Sunglasses Hut and Pearle Vision, giving Google the ability to showcase its new designs in brick-and-mortar stores.

United Airlines to offer hundreds of movies, tv shows for free streaming on Apple devices, laptops

Starting in April, flying may be just a little bit more bearable. United Airlines recently announced passengers will be able to watch hundreds of television shows and movies for free on their laptops and Apple devices. To watch the free entertainment, which includes around 200 shows and 150 films, passengers will have to download the United Airlines application or install a browser plug-in, based on the device they're using. From there, customers can watch any of the content 
available without needing to pay for WiFi. The 
aircraft company expects most of their domestic 
planes to have the service by the end of this year.

Netflix's book marks your spot when you drift off to sleep

We’ve all been there: You’re getting drowsy and you’ve got school or work early the next morning, but you’re four hours deep into a Dexter  binge-watching session and there’s no way you’re dragging yourself to bed until you wrap just one more episode. But eventually, biology wins and you end up passing out on the couch during the ninth episode.The hack is a collaboration with Fitbit, a maker of fitness tracking bands, according to a post on Netflix’s blog.Presumably, the device is connected wirelessly via Bluetooth to whatever you’re using to watch Netflix.When you fall asleep, the Fitbit informs Netflix, which then pauses whatever show or movie you’re watching, simultaneously setting a sleep bookmark so you’ll be able to pick up where you left off the next day.
